The cheapest way to get from Cascais to Cassis is to line 19000 train and fly and train which costs €65 - €210 and takes 7h 18m.
The fastest way to get from Cascais to Cassis is to line 19000 train and fly and train which takes 7h 18m and costs €65 - €210.
The distance between Cascais and Cassis is 1399 km. The road distance is 1687.6 km.
The best way to get from Cascais to Cassis without a car is to bus and train which takes 29h 39m and costs €150 - €300.
It takes approximately 7h 18m to get from Cascais to Cassis, including transfers.
Cassis is 1h ahead of Cascais. It is currently 2:49 PM in Cascais and 3:49 PM in Cassis.
Yes, the driving distance between Cascais to Cassis is 1688 km. It takes approximately 16h 14m to drive from Cascais to Cassis.
